A father and his adopted son become nationally famous evangelists. Their personal war with each other causes the empire they build to fall. Religion and its fears are confronted by New Age values and discoveries of the self. These create a resounding clash as suspicions are confirmed in this gripping story of challenges to morals, ethics, values and todays religious beliefs. Questions that we ourselves fear to ask pierce this complex story of brutality, murder, love and hate, propelling the characters through a jungle of deceit, international financial dealing and personal danger. Set in tropical Florida, this work of fiction blends intrigue and psyche shattering emotion with state of the art technology, and the most sophisticated levels of psychological trickery. Though it could pass as a mini-course in mind control, THE BECOMING reflects the greatest hopes, the greatest fears, and the dynamics of the human condition that we all experience today.
